Transaction 33cc70a91ef7d44f30eba53b9d9fac856701f69f4eaa2b05075922f029b635ae

1 Input
2 Outputs
  • 33cc70a91ef7d44f30eba53b9d9fac856701f69f4eaa2b05075922f029b635ae:0
  • value  82000
    address  3BMdbrCM96ZxxTg6Jhc2Q4jWrik7ZSn7hN
  • 33cc70a91ef7d44f30eba53b9d9fac856701f69f4eaa2b05075922f029b635ae:1
  • value  876995
    address  bc1q2y6vevfrpv4y893dr6f4ckxlrmm23l33zq0nvq